
#menu { position: relative; height: 121px; background: url(../images/menu.gif) bottom no-repeat; border-bottom: 3px solid #0D469D; }
#menulogo { position: absolute; left: 35px; top: 20px; }
#menuidioma { position: absolute; left: 15px; top: 95px; font: bold 10px "Trebuchet MS", Arial, Helvetica, sans-serif; color: #000; }
#menutelefono { position: absolute; right: 8px; top: 25px; }

#botmenutop { position: absolute; right: 0; top: 59px; }
a#botmenutop1 { display: block; float: left; width: 44px; height: 20px; background: url(../images/menutop1_in.gif) 0 0 no-repeat; }
a#botmenutop2 { display: block; float: left; width: 87px; height: 20px; background: url(../images/menutop2_in.gif) 0 0 no-repeat; }
a#botmenutop3 { display: block; float: left; width: 73px; height: 20px; background: url(../images/menutop3_in.gif) 0 0 no-repeat; }
a#botmenutop4 { display: block; float: left; width: 77px; height: 20px; background: url(../images/menutop4_in.gif) 0 0 no-repeat; }
a#botmenutop5 { display: block; float: left; width: 46px; height: 20px; background: url(../images/menutop5_in.gif) 0 0 no-repeat; }
a#botmenutop6 { display: block; float: left; width: 55px; height: 20px; background: url(../images/menutop6.gif) 0 0 no-repeat; }
a#botmenutop7 { display: block; float: left; width: 59px; height: 20px; background: url(../images/menutop7_in.gif) 0 0 no-repeat; }

#botmenutop a:hover { background-position: 0 -20px; }

#botmenu { position: absolute; right: 8px; top: 80px; }
#botmenu1 { display: block; float: left; width: 132px; height: 40px; background: url(../images/menu1.gif) 0 0 no-repeat; }
#botmenu2 { display: block; float: left; width: 120px; height: 40px; background: url(../images/menu2.gif) 0 0 no-repeat; }
#botmenu3 { display: block; float: left; width: 277px; height: 40px; background: url(../images/menu3_in.gif) 0 0 no-repeat; }

#botmenu a:hover { background-position: 0 -40px; }

#todo { position: relative; }
#cuadro { position: relative; padding: 20px; border: 1px solid #0D469D; border-width: 4px 1px 1px; background: url(../images/fondo_contenido.gif) right bottom no-repeat; }

#pie { position: relative; height: 80px; background: url(../images/pie.gif) no-repeat; }
#logopie { position: absolute; left: 0; top: 3px; }
#textopie { position: absolute; left: 220px; top: 6px; }
#textopie, #textopie a { color: #FFF; font: 10px Tahoma, Helvetica, Arial, sans-serif; }

#veiss { display: block; position: absolute; left: 710px; top: 30px; width: 45px; height: 15px; background: url(../images/veiss.gif) 0 0 no-repeat; }
#veiss:hover { background-position: 0 -15px; }
